Tiger Woods, the iconic golfer with 15 major wins, underwent a spinal fusion surgery in October to replace the damaged L4-L5 disc in his lower back. This procedure aims to alleviate pain and improve his mobility, potentially enabling him to return to competitive golf. The surgery marks another chapter in Woods’ long history of back issues, as he has previously undergone multiple microdiscectomy procedures and a previous spinal fusion. His recovery timeline remains uncertain, but fans hope he will be able to play again in the future.
